Output d8a54acc03aba3ff7830d86891995608e8f86bae56fcab2c566ebb0e8aba75ed:990

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8389965c1d105af4d691776ed652d68a9d6df2e521a6f5ca7ebf235f10dc08c0
address
tb1pswyevhqazpd0f453wahdv5kk32wkmuh9yxn0tjn7hu347yxuprqqjgzvdt
transaction
d8a54acc03aba3ff7830d86891995608e8f86bae56fcab2c566ebb0e8aba75ed